I have a mixed reef, soft, lps and sps corals.. what is the best all round Red Sea supplement or foundation elements I should look to dose my tank with to help improve coral growth
 
You need to test all of your foundation elements, magnesium calcium alkalinity and then add the relevant Red Sea foundation elements A B and C individually to maintain the correct parameters your aiming for. Depending on the size of your tank you could also look at ABC+ skeletal elements

There are also the Coral Colours to maintain trace elements etc
